Synaptics Emweb Global Footprint

Top 10 Identified Countries

Country Observations Percentage
US 13,286 32.87%
KR 3,237 8.01%
JP 1,958 4.84%
DE 1,522 3.77%
AU 1,404 3.47%
IN 1,328 3.29%
CN 1,148 2.84%
CA 1,147 2.84%
SG 1,102 2.73%
GB 1,054 2.61%

Bitsight, the leading provider in Cyber Risk Management, introduced the next-generation internet scanner Bitsight Groma in May 2024. This technology continuously scans the entire internet to discover assets, collect asset attribution evidence, and identify an ever-growing set of security observations, such as vulnerabilities and misconfigurations. Groma’s scanning activities presently encompass:


  • 40 million-plus monitored organizations
  • 250 million-plus host names
  • 4 billion-plus routable IPv4 and IPv6 addresses
